Riding the TIDES: Community Health Adaptation to Flooding in Bulacan

Background: Flooding represents more than an environmental issue; it poses a profound threat to livelihoods and psychological well-being. For families living in chronically flood-prone areas, it has become a constant fight for survival. Purpose: Although previous studies have examined flood adaptation and disaster resilience, limited research has explored how residents themselves perceive, experience, and adapt to flood-related health challenges through their own visual narratives. To address this gap, this study sought to explore the community health adaptation strategies of barangay residents, the challenges they face, and their aspirations for a healthier, more resilient future. Methods: Using a qualitative photovoice design, 17 purposively selected flood-affected residents documented lived experiences through photographs discussed in semi-structured interviews and focus group discussions. Data underwent inductive thematic analysis. Trustworthiness was ensured through member checking, triangulation, reflexivity, audit trails, and peer debriefing, and code-recoding procedures. Results: The core theme, Riding the TIDES, captured the dynamic process of adapting, persevering, and striving toward resilience amidst flooding. Five themes emerged: (1) Trussed Boundaries of Inundation, (2) Iterative Pathways of Acclimatization, (3) Dialogues of Meaning-Making, (4) Emerging Consciousness of Needs and Aspirations, and (5) Shared Agency and Sustained Solidarity. Conclusion: The findings reveal that adaptation to chronic flooding transcends physical survival and encompasses resilience-building, meaning-making, and collective empowerment. The study contributes a participant-driven understanding of how chronic flood exposure fosters a nuanced form of toxic resilience, in which adaptive capacities coexist with enduring structural vulnerabilities and aspirations for systemic change.
